The Michelin Guide's review
Perched at an altitude of 3 850m on a bare plateau 15km south of Lake Titicaca, the city of Tiahuanaco,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, has retained its air of mystery. Its golden age was between the 7C and 9C AD, but it was the capital of a culture that extended from 1600 BC to 1200 AD and spread to Ayacucho and Nazca. Only the ceremonial centre has stood the test of time; the museum artefacts, monumental carved stones and semi-subterranean temple are impressive.
